After surprisingly firing head coach Mike Brown on December 27th, the Sacramento Kings have posted a 5-1 record, including five straight wins.

The Athletic’s Sam Amick joined The Carmichael Dave Show with Jason Ross to share his observations of how Sacramento has performed under interim head coach Doug Christie, relay his intel on where De’Aaron Fox currently stands with the organization, and much more.

Plus, are the Kings still shaping up to be aggressive in the trade market in the coming weeks?

Topics Discussed

  • Sacramento is 5-1 under interim head coach Doug Christie. Why have they appeared to turn the corner?
  • What is next for Mike Brown? Will he seek another head coaching role or join a team as an assistant?
  • Sam says Mike will remain in the area for the short term and could join a team as their lead assistant in the summer.
  • Has De’Aaron Fox’s relationship with the organization been damaged even further?
  • “It’s just not a healthy move to not have a press conference… Nobody is willing to step up and grab the microphone.”
  • Sam thinks “the writing is on the wall” for Fox’s eventual exit from the Kings.
  • How is Sacramento approaching the trade deadline with Fox’s future unclear?
  • “There are people around the league that have the belief that the Kings should move De’Aaron now.”
  • Sacramento has played some solid basketball, but the schedule gets difficult coming up.
  • Sam says the Kings front office will continue to have an aggressive approach to the trade deadline.
  • “I continue to hear that they are involved in a lot. They’re trying to improve the team.”
  • Are Keegan Murray and Devin Carter available on the trade block?
  • Was Vivek Ranadive correct to have hesitancy in extending Brown?

When is the next Sacramento Kings game?

Sacramento will leave the state of California for the first time since December 12th as they embark on a three-game road trip that begins with a matchup against the reigning NBA champion Boston Celtics on Friday afternoon.

The Kings have lost six straight games against the Celtics and haven’t won a game at TD Garden since March 19, 2021.
